## Deployment

The Lumacache image service has a known slow leak in its thumbnail cache layer: evicted entries keep a reference alive through the decoder pool, so resident memory creeps up roughly 40 MB per hour under steady load. Until the refactor in the Harkness branch lands, we mitigate by capping pool size and scheduling a rolling restart every 12 hours. Deploy with the supervisor, never bare, or the restart hook won't fire. The deployment relies on the configuration values listed below.

settings of bagug-tahof:
holath:
  pin: 7837
  metrics_host: metrics.holath.tolvaqsys.internal
  tenant: quenath
  seal: seal_6001b3af

Leadership Review Briefing — Licensing Dispute
For heads of department, Tessellate Labs.

Negotiations with Fernova Media over the Cascade codec licence have stalled on retroactive fees. Counsel rates our position as defensible but recommends a structured settlement to avoid discovery costs. Operational impact so far is limited to a paused feature release. Please review the confidential planning note appended below before the session.

confidential, kajof-tahof: The pricing group signed off on a budget of $491.8 million for Project Casvan.

Ticket: Drift in Copperfin image slimming config

Prod builds use the slimmed base image; staging quietly reverted to the fat one after last month's rebuild, so image sizes diverge and reviews are misleading. Please confirm the diff restores parity before approving. Expected production values are as follows.

service settings:
PRAWYN_PIN=9848
PRAWYN_METRICS_HOST=metrics.prawyn.lumicworks.corp
PRAWYN_LOG_LEVEL=warn
PRAWYN_TENANT=pelius